2014 Grey Sands Pinot Noir
Wine Rating
94
An uncompromising producer from the Tamar Valley, the wines are held back in bottle for close to a decade in some instances and are the definition of hand crafted in limited quantities. The 2014 Pinot Noir is bold with layers of interest; on the nose there is plum, cherry, sandalwood spice, fresh earth / undergrowth and with time come some charcuterie notes.
Spiced raspberry and strawberry fruit, broad and textured with layers of spice alongside grippy and earthen tannin. Black cherry and prune have impact to finish with generous, but integrated french oak richness a final embellishment.
